Output d1976f2935d2ebf8c39d19422b0cb02c04bc1208fa4d5a5af8aeb2e0adc3b590: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d508ff65bfda08c71ba807f49700381266a1d5a OP_EQUAL
address
MC2m9dfZKZJ617QjxoZnQbdwTgSWjf5N2a
transaction
d1976f2935d2ebf8c39d19422b0cb02c04bc1208fa4d5a5af8aeb2e0adc3b590
spent
true